Adventure Tips

Choose the right poles

Use adjustable hiking poles for customizable support on varying terrain.

Maintain your gear

Regularly check and clean your poles and ice cleats for optimal performance.

Use proper technique

Rely on your poles for balance and to reduce knee strain during descents.

Try different tips

Switch between rubber feet and snow baskets based on trail conditions.
